I use OE since over ten years and was always happy with it. It is a simple
and practical tool. Some months ago I deinstalled XP professional and loaded
Winmdows 2000 professional. All worked fine, I made all available upgrades,
all worked fine... but since the last security upgrade in December 06 Or
January 07 - it was some automatic thingy - Outlook Express hides all the
attachments of all the emails. I cannot open nor store them anymore... In the
beginning it said that it does not enable their opening because they are a
security thread...(viri) but there was none in reality... I found a
workaround (trick) to open them anyway but I would prefere to see them again
unveiled in the normal way and to be allowed to open them... What can I do...?
